Step 1: download required

Before you start customizing, you need to download some applications and packages to make the new look. Click the links to download or access directly from Google Play on your gadget.

  • Nova Launcher: interface changes (check out the full tutorial here). If you have Android 2.3 installed, you can opt for Holo Launcher.
  • Pack of icons: 80 icons Download chrisbanks2 on Deviantart
  • Wallpaper: an exclusive image stand taken by Baixaki
  • EZ Weather: The widget clock, date and weather
  • Super Screen Lock: Creates a special lock screen
  • Wizardrii Wallpaper: To insert a wallpaper with correct proportions
  • ES File Explorer: File and folder manager for Android

Step 3: Configuring the New Launcher

Time to modify the new interface to let her with the look and functions that both want. When installing the application on the device, press the “Home” button and select the application. Then select the “Always”, so that the interface is accessed when you return to the Home screen.

Launcher Settings and go to the “Desktop” item to make the following settings:

  • “Grid Desktop”, change the option to 9×6. If owners do not like the proportion of devices with small screens, just adjust the ratio to other values.
  • Under “Margin Width”, check the “Borderless”.
  • Repeat the above procedure, now in “Margin Height”.
  • “Home Screens”, we suggest leaving only a screen. Drag the others up to eliminate them.
  • Uncheck ‘Label Icons “that the application names do not appear below the icons.

Finally, exit the “Desktop” tab and go to “Appearance”. There, uncheck “Display notification bar” so that it’s appearing on the screen. But do not worry. Warnings you still receive calls, messages and other activities and just slide your finger on the spot where the bar was originally for it to appear

Step 6: Clock and Weather

Now it’s time to insert the widget that brings data like weather, clock and date. He will be at the top of the screen, occupying the space left blank by the bookshelf. To activate it, tap the screen for a few seconds, select the “Widgets” option and locate options EZ Weather.

Select the Fully Transparent widget and click “Apply.” You can resize the box to the size you see fit on the screen.


Step 7: Lock screen

This is the easiest step: Open your Super Lock Screen, select the option that best suits you and tap “Enable”. If in doubt, we recommend the effects “Pass”, “Island” and “Minimalist”.
